Province Syria Coele
Region Syria
City Antioch
Reign Macrinus
Person (obv.) Diadumenian (Caesar)
Obverse inscription ΚΑΙ Μ Ο ΔΙ(Α) ΑΝΤΩΝ(Ε)ΙΝΟϹ (ϹΕ)
Edition Καῖ(σαρ) Μ(ᾶρκος) Ὀ(πέλλιος) Δια(δουμένιανος) Ἀντωνεῖνος Σε(βαστοῦ)
Translation Caesar Marcus Opellius Diadumenianus Antoninus son of the Augustus
Obverse design bare-headed, draped and cuirassed bust of Diadumenian, right, seen from front
Reverse inscription S C, Δ Ε
Edition S(enatus) C(onsulto) δ ἐ(παρχιῶν)
Translation by decree of the Senate, of the 4 eparchies
Reverse design within laurel wreath; star at top of the wreath
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 18 mm
Average weight 4.57 g
Axis 5, 6, 11, 12
Reference McAlee 747a
